Abstract
The invention discloses a kind of needle holders and its application method for radio-frequency ablation electrode needle, the needle holder for radio-frequency ablation electrode needle includes pedestal, supporting rod and clamping part, pedestal is arranged in bottom, supporting rod has pliability, the lower end of supporting rod and one end of pedestal connect, and the upper end of supporting rod connect with clamping part and supports clamping part.A kind of needle holder for radio-frequency ablation electrode needle of the present invention, realizing can be as required to the fixed effect of electrode needle in radio-frequency ablation procedure, and without specially transferring, manpower is hand-held to be fixed, it is ensured that while operation safety, also saves operation cost.

Background technology
3~4 electrode catheters are sent into coronary vein by radio-frequency ablation procedure i.e. under local anaesthesia through femoral vein, subclavian vein
The positions such as sinus, high right atrium and Xinier reservoir, right ventricle, stimulation atrium and ventricle induce the tachycardia consistent with clinic, fixed
Position tachycardia originating point, then by the electrode catheter of ablation be sent to oriented originating point and with external radio-frequency signal generator
It is connected, electrophysiologic study is repeated after electric discharge, if tachycardia cannot be induced and Clinical Follow-up is without breaking-out, illustrates to melt successfully,
The electrode needle for being presently used for radiofrequency ablation therapy is thicker, and in order to reduce the damage to patient, when radiofrequency ablation therapy makes every effort to primary
It punctures successfully, still, CT guiding belongs to non real-time guiding, and needing repeatedly to adjust electrode needle can make its position accurate, in order to subtract
Few damage, then should subcutaneously adjust as possible, since electrode needle has constant weight, often occur in existing radio-frequency ablation procedure subcutaneous
The problem for organizing that electrode needle cannot be made to fix, existing settling mode are that doctor holds fixation, and hand-held fix has occupancy manpower,
The problem of increasing operation cost, in addition, the problem of arm fatiguability leads to electrode needle unsteady attitude when the hand-held time is long, electrode
Needle unsteady attitude results in the problem of cannot carrying out effective electrode needle catheter path verification, to reduce electrode pin puncture
Accuracy and one-time successful puncture rate.
